Job Title: Nurse Practitioner-Cardiovascular Institute-Mount Sinai Hospital-Full Time-Day

Job Summary:

We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Nurse Practitioner to join our team at the Cardiovascular Institute at Mount Sinai Hospital. As a Nurse Practitioner, you will play a critical role in providing high-quality patient care and contributing to the advancement of cardiovascular medicine.

Responsibilities:

  • Assess the health status of patients/families by means of comprehensive health history and physical examination.
  • Initiate and order selected therapeutic and diagnostic procedures, consultations and laboratory examination, prescribes medication regimens, interprets findings and alters plan of care according to accepted standards of care and practice guidelines.
  • Educates and counsels in the areas of health promotion, maintenance, disease prevention, and management of acute/chronic illnesses.
  • Documents findings and plan of care in the patient's medical record.
  • Consults with physician according to established standards, policies, procedures, and protocols.
  • Demonstrates the knowledge and skills necessary to provide care, based on physical, psychosocial, educational, safety, and related criteria, appropriate to the age of the patients served in assigned area.
  • Initiates referrals to specialty services and fosters continuity of care.
  • Participates in team meetings and conferences to enhance an interdisciplinary approach to care delivery.
  • Maintains patient/employee confidentiality in the management of information.
  • Develops the plan of care based on the diagnoses and individual patient needs, records, reports, and interprets the clients' responses to the plan of care.
  • Performs a patient record review with the collaborating physician in a timely fashion but not less than every three months if utilizing a collaborative practice agreement.
  • Completes the Focused Professional Practice Proctoring Evaluation (FPPE) or the Ongoing Professional Practice Proctoring Evaluation (OPPE) as required by Medical Staff for continued credentialing status.
  • Practices as a member of the allied health staff according to the rules and regulations of the Medical Staff and the bylaws of the Hospital Staff.

Requirements:

  • Master's degree program designed to prepare a NP to diagnose, treat, and prescribe for a patients condition that fall within their specialty area of practice or the successful completion of an approved supplemental education program.
  • Previous progressive experience relevant to the area of clinical practice required.
  • For all NPs hired effective June 1, 2019, National Board Certification in Advanced Practice Nursing required.
  • For NPs who bill for professional services, National Board Certification is required regardless of hire date.
  • The Board Certification requirement may be deferred up to 1 year if approved by Chief Nursing Officer or designee.
  • Credentialed through the Credentialing Committee of the Medical Board with approved Delineation of Privileges.
  • Drug Enforcement Administration (DEA) certificate and Basic Life Support (BLS) certification required.
  • Advan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S),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S), Neonatal Advanced Life Support (NALS), The Neonatal Resuscitation Program (NRP) certificates as required by specialty.
